Ecosystem Approaches Defined

Ecosystem approaches represent a line of thought and methodological strategies for analyzing and modeling the complex system of biophysical interrelationships, including humans, that define the biosphere. They take the ecosystem as a unit of study and search, through existing knowledge, for unifying principles to explain its organization and dynamics. This helps to understand the workings of the natural environment and the cause-effect relationships that are established when these principles are applied.

Goals of Ecosystem Approaches

The ultimate goal of an ecosystem approach is to facilitate the creation of exploitation-conservation models for the natural environment, including resources that are sustainable over the long term.

Thus, the ecosystem approach is involved in characterizing ecosystems associated with production-conservation, which relates to ecological health or the ability of these systems to sustainably provide human resources.

For an ecosystem to be healthy, it must maintain its structure, functioning, and development over time, in addition to its relative stability (resilience).

Three Aspects of Systematic Approaches

Systematic approaches incorporate three key aspects:

  • Ecological purposes: Considering biotic and abiotic factors.
  • Economic purposes: Including scales of values and economic population dynamics.
  • Institutional purposes: Addressing financing, laws, and human capital.

Core Areas in Ecosystem Application

Ecosystem approaches are also based on key elements in their application, focusing on areas such as:

  • Time: Linking immediate actions within a broader, long-term perspective.
  • Space: Focusing on an area representative of heterogeneity and variability to ensure resilience, even in challenging years.

Key Actions & Stakeholder Involvement

Effective implementation of the ecosystem approach involves several key actions and considerations for stakeholder involvement:

  1. Develop a common vision (social and economic).
  2. Coordinate efforts through collaboration.
  3. Utilize ecological principles for restoration and maintenance.
  4. Align actions with socio-economic objectives.
  5. Respect and ensure individual rights and private property; foster private cooperation.
  6. Address system complexity.
  7. Employ adaptive approaches.
  8. Integrate science into decision-making.
  9. Establish basic conditions for ecosystem functioning and sustainability.

Understanding Resilience

Resilience is the ability of a species or ecosystem to adapt or recover from extreme conditions by itself.

The Adaptive Management Cycle

Adaptive management follows a structured cycle:

  1. Define mission and goals: Develop conceptual models to understand the system.
  2. Develop management plan: Formulate a plan with specific goals and objectives.
  3. Develop monitoring plan: Outline how progress and effects will be tracked.
  4. Implement management and monitoring: Put the management actions and monitoring plan into effect.
  5. Analyze data and discuss results: Evaluate the collected data and discuss findings.
  6. Learn and adapt: Use insights gained to adjust and improve future management strategies.

Defining Ecosystem Management

Ecosystem Management encompasses a set of strategies aimed at maintaining the full range of ecological values and functions at the landscape level.
